50 Years into the Clean Water Act, Drinking Water Sources Still at Risk
Most drinking water in the United States—approximately 2/3—comes from above ground sources such as rivers, lakes, and streams. These surface waters are extremely vulnerable to pollution from human activities. Polluted runoff from farms, stockyards, roads, as well as industrial discharges of pollution ranging from coal plants to chemical manufacturers, threaten our drinking water sources across the country.

Colorado Test Results Reveal Contaminated Drinking Water
“CDPHE’s water testing results highlight the need for the state to do more to protect our communities from PFAS,” said Jennifer Peters, Water Programs Director at Clean Water Action. “Polluters should not be allowed to dump these chemicals into our water, and I urge the Colorado Water Quality Control Commission to pass a strong narrative water policy to rein in discharges of PFAS into Colorado waters.”
